Stationary objects and vehicles
The device cannot detect the presence of
stationary vehicles or objects. For
example, the device will not operate if
the vehicle ahead leaves the lane and a
vehicle ahead of that one is standing on
the lane. Pay the utmost attention at all
times and be always ready to press the
brakes if needed.
Objects and cars moving in opposite or
crosswise direction
The device cannot detect the presence of
objects or vehicles travelling in opposite
or at right-angles and consequently will
not be operated.

VERSIONS WITH 4/8 SENSORS
The parking sensors, located in the rear
bumper fig. 109 (4-channel versions) or
front and rear fig. 110 (8-channel
versions), detect the presence of any
obstacles and warn the driver about
them, through an acoustic warning and,
where provided, visual indications on the
instrument panel display.On/off
To disengage the system press button
fig. 111.
The LED in the button will light up or not
when the system switches from on to off
and vice versa:
LED off: system activated;
LED light on steady: system
deactivated;
If the button is pressed with a systemfailure, the LED flashes for about
5 seconds, then it stays on constantly.
System activation/deactivation
When the reverse gear is engaged, the
system when engaged, activates the
front and rear sensors (where provided).
When the reverse gear is engaged and
the system is on, the front and rear
sensors are activated. If a different gear
is engaged, the rear sensors are
deactivated, while the front sensors
remain active until 9.3 mph (15 km/h) are
exceeded.
Operation with a trailer
The operation of the rear sensors is
automatically deactivated when the
trailer is plugged to the tow hook socket
of the car, while the front sensors (where
provided) stay active and can provide
acoustic and visual warnings.
The sensors are automatically
reactivated when the trailer's cable plug
is removed.
Important notes
Some conditions may influence the
performance of the parking system:
reduced sensor sensitivity and a
reduction in the parking assistance
system performance could be due to the
presence of: ice, snow, mud, thick paint,
on the surface of the sensor;
10907176S0001EM
11007176S0003EM
11107176S0002EM
128
STARTING AND DRIVING
Page 131 of 232

the sensor may detect a non-existent
obstacle ("echo interference") due to
mechanical interference, for example
when washing the vehicle, in rain (strong
wind), hail;
the signals sent by the sensor can also
be altered by the presence of ultrasonic
systems (e.g. pneumatic brake systems
of trucks or pneumatic drills) near the
vehicle;
parking assistance system
performance can also be influenced by
the position of the sensors, for example
due to a change in the ride setting
(caused by wear to the shock absorbers,
suspension), or by changing tyres,
overloading the vehicle or carrying out
specific tuning operations that require
the vehicle to be lowered;
the presence of a tow hook without
trailer, which may interfere with the
correct operation of the parking sensors.
Before using the Park Sensors system, it
is recommended to remove the
removable tow hook ball assembly and
the relevant attachment from the car
when the latter is not used for towing
operations. Failure to comply with this
prescription may cause personal injuries
or damage to vehicles or obstacles since,
when the continuous acoustic signal is
emitted, the tow hook ball is already in a
position that is much closer to the
obstacle than the rear bumper. If youwish to leave the tow hook fitted without
towing a trailer, it is advisable to contact
an Alfa Romeo Dealership for the Park
Sensors system update operations
because the tow hook could be detected
as an obstacle by the central sensors.
the presence of adhesives on the
sensors. Therefore, take care not to place
stickers on the sensors.

LANE DEPARTURE WARNING
(LDW) SYSTEM
DESCRIPTION
51) 52) 53) 54) 55) 56)
The Lane Departure Warning system
makes use of a camera located on the
windscreen to detect the lane limits and
calculate the position of the vehicle
within such limits, in order to make sure
that it remains inside the lane.
When one or both lane limits are
detected and the vehicle passes over one
without the driver's say-so (direction
indicator not turned on), the system
emits an acoustic signal.
If the vehicle continues to go beyond the
line of the lane without any intervention
from the driver, the surpassed line will
light up on the display (left or right) to
urge the driver to bring the vehicle back
into the limits of the lane.
SYSTEM ON/OFF
The system is activated/deactivated by
pressing the button fig. 112
Each time the engine is started, the
system maintains the operating mode
that was selected when it was previously
switched off.Activation conditions
Once switched on, the system becomes
active only if the following conditions are
met:
the car speed is higher than 37 mph
(the system is deactivated at speeds
equal to or higher than 110 mph –
180 km/h);
the lane limit lines are visible at least
on one side;
there are suitable visibility conditions;
the road is straight or with wide radius
bends;
a suitable distance is kept from the
vehicle in front;
the direction indicator (for leaving the
lane) is not active.

REFUELLING THE VEHICLE
125) 126) 127)
Always stop the engine before refuelling.
PETROL ENGINES
Only use unleaded petrol with a number
of octanes (R.O.N.) not lower than 91
(EN228 specification).
DIESEL ENGINES
Only use automotive diesel fuel
(EN590 and EN16734 specifications).
Operation at low temperatures
If the outside temperature is very low,
Diesel thickens due to the formation of
paraffin clots with consequent defective
operation of the fuel supply system.
In order to avoid these problems,
different types of diesel are distributed
according to the season: summer type,
winter type and arctic type (cold,
mountain areas).
In the event of refuelling with diesel
which is unsuitable for the operating
temperature, it is advisable to mix the
diesel with a specific additive,
introducing it to the tank before the
anti-freeze and then the diesel.

REFUELLING PROCEDURE
The fuel flap is unlocked when the central
door locking system is released, while it
is automatically locked when the central
locking system is applied.
Opening the flap
To refuel proceed as follows:
open flap 1fig. 115, pressing on the
point shown by the arrow fig. 116;
remove the closing cap 2 fig. 115;
put the cap back in position;
introduce the dispenser in the filler 3
fig. 115 and refuel;
after refuelling, before removing the
dispenser, wait for at least 10 seconds in
order for the fuel to flow inside the tank;
then remove the dispenser from the
filler, close the cap and then close the
flap.The refuelling procedure described
previously is illustrated on the label
applied inside the fuel flap.
The label also has the fuel type
(UNLEADED FUEL = petrol; DIESEL =
diesel fuel) and the symbol that certifies
compliance with the EN228 (petrol),
EN590 and EN16734 (diesel) standards,
fig. 117.TOPPING UP AdBlue® DIESEL

Fuels - identification of vehicle
compatibility. Graphic symbol for
consumer information in accordance
with EN16942
The symbols, shown below, make it easier
to recognise the correct fuel type to use
with your car.
Before refuelling, check the symbols
(where provided) inside the fuel filler flap
and compare them with the symbols
shown on the fuel pump (where provided).
Symbols for petrol powered cars
E5: unleaded petrol containing up to
2.7% (m/m) oxygen and with maximum
5.0% (V/V) ethanol compliant with the
EN228 specification.
E10: unleaded petrol containing up to
3.7% (m/m) oxygen and with maximum
10.0% (V/V) ethanol compliant with the
EN228 specification.
